摘要
our agricultural face: agricultural production is dispersed, agricultural consumption is diversified, and connection and docking are poor between small-scale production and market. We propose the agricultural marketing information recommendation system based on cloud computing in order to provide accurate recommendations for farmers. The main function modules include information acquisition and preprocessing module, user interest module based on explicit and implicit build, recommendation algorithm module based on a combination of BP neural network and SOM neural network. System implementation results show that recommendation result is accurate, the system operate normally and can achieve good economic benefits. We can achieve the desired design objectives.
